Gary Wegman (Democratic Party) ran for election to the U.S. House to represent Pennsylvania's 9th Congressional District. He lost in the general election on November 3, 2020.

General election

General election for U.S. House Pennsylvania District 9

Incumbent Dan Meuser defeated Gary Wegman in the general election for U.S. House Pennsylvania District 9 on November 3, 2020.

Candidate
%
Votes
Image of Dan Meuser
Dan Meuser (R)
 
66.3
 
232,988
Image of Gary Wegman
Gary Wegman (D) Candidate Connection
 
33.7
 
118,266

Total votes: 351,254

Democratic primary election

Democratic primary for U.S. House Pennsylvania District 9

Gary Wegman defeated Laura Quick in the Democratic primary for U.S. House Pennsylvania District 9 on June 2, 2020.

Candidate
%
Votes
Image of Gary Wegman
Gary Wegman Candidate Connection
 
51.0
 
27,451
Image of Laura Quick
Laura Quick
 
49.0
 
26,385

Total votes: 53,836

Gary Wegman completed Ballotpedia's Candidate Connection survey in 2020. The survey questions appear in bold and are followed by Wegman's responses. Candidates are asked three required questions for this survey, but they may answer additional optional questions as well.

Expand all | Collapse all

I have dedicated my life to serving my community: as a dentist, as a farmer, and as a father and husband. I was raised on a working family farm in the Oley Valley where I learned to live the values of hard work, fair play, and equality. I am running for Congress because the people of Pennsylvania need someone to serve their needs. I am willing to take the tough stances necessary to move our country forward and elevate our region and our communities. As one of the few medical professionals running for Congress, I know our healthcare system inside and out. As a small business owner, I have balanced budgets, made payroll, and created jobs in our region - at my medical practice and on my farm. While serving on the board of the Reading Redevelopment Authority, I worked to successfully redevelop and renovate blighted properties at a brownfield site. As chairman of the Reading Parking Authority, I oversaw public parking facilities and helped to manage public resources effectively for the community - a trait career politicians in Washington could learn from. Through these experiences, I have come to understand that none of us succeed unless we all succeed. This is the attitude that I will bring to Washington to overcome the partisan gridlock and create better opportunities for the people of the 9th District.
  • We need a 50-state single-payer system where doctors, hospitals, and other healthcare providers "compete" in the private marketplace for our public dollars. I'm not going to change how our healthcare is provided, I just want to change the way we pay for it.
  • As a 5th generation farmer, I understand small business values and the hardships of owning a rural business. That's why I will champion District-wide Broadband rollout, provide incentives for hemp processing, and work to bring a cheese and yogurt manufacturing facility to the 9th District to leverage Pennsylvania's surplus milk supply.
  • I know that education isn't a "one-size-fits-all." I will fight to equitably fund our public schools and create quality Pre-K educational programs. I will support trade schools and community colleges so that everyone can have access to an affordable education that's right for them.
Throughout my 36 years as a dentist, I have watched as career politicians have broken our healthcare system. I have seen too many patients who lack sufficient insurance coverage. Too many people in our region have had to make tough choices between rent or medicine, between paying for groceries or seeing a doctor. Too much of our money goes to insurance company and pharmaceutical industry profits. I will pass HR3, a bill that will allow the government to negotiate with the pharmaceutical industry to determine a fair price for medications, and reach across the aisle to find solutions to lower the cost of healthcare.
